I’m not as good as Saif on guitar: Farhan Akhtar
Mumbai, (IANS) Saif Ali Khan isn’t the only one who’s unveiled a
secret passion for playing the guitar. Director Farhan Akhtar, who
plays a rock musician in Abhishek Kapoor’s “Rock On”, also knows
how to strum but says he is not as good.
Now that Saif and Farhan are working together in the latter’s “Voice
From The Sky”, will they be jamming together?
“I don’t mind, but I don’t think I’m as good as Saif on the guitar. Not
that we’re in competition or anything,” Farhan, who ventured into
showbiz with the successful directorial venture “Dil Chahta Hai”, told
IANS.
Unlike Farhan, Saif has performed at a few concerts and also played
the guitar with the Indi-rock band Parikrama.
For Farhan, “Rock On” was like a dream come true.
“Playing the rock musician in ‘Rock On’ has been a wild fantasy come
true for me. I’ve been playing the guitar for eight years now. When I
was 14, I heard Guns ‘N’ Roses do their song ‘Appetite for destruction’
and I was hooked. I wanted to be a rock star.
“The timing for ‘Rock On’ was just right. When I met Abhishek Kapoor
and he told me about my role of a musician, I grabbed it. I had the time
to sharpen my skills on the strings. It gave me a chance to play out a
secret fantasy. I really enjoyed it.”
“Rock On” recreates the musical mischievous masti of Farhan’s “Dil
Chahta Hai”. And Farhan is all praise for his musicians.
“They’ve all been wonderful - Luke Kenny, Arjun Rampal, Prachi
Desai and Shahana. We’re all happy working together and meeting
when we’ve time. That feeling of bonding shows up on screen.”
The film will be released by the end of August.
“I don’t think Saif is planning to cut an album before me,” Farhan
joked. “I’m really looking forward to working with him. For ‘Voice
From The Sky’, we both go back to the turn of the last century.”
